Bwave Audio Recording Module.

Montreal, January 08, 2009.

The Bwave Audio Recording Module allows users to record audio sources to a separate wav / bwav compatible file, while the video is recorded to a StreamPix sequence file. Furthermore, the module maintains audio signal in synch with video, provided there is sufficient disk bandwidth available for recording both media.

The module generates 3 possible audio file formats:

  • Standard wave file;
  • Single bwave file: The whole audio stream is recorded into a single continuous bwav compatible file format (default);
  • Multiple bwave: Allows the recording to be paused. Upon resume, a new bwav file is added and linked to the previous file.

Bwave file format is only supported by QuickTime Player. It is not supported by Windows Media Player. Bwave format is based on wav audio format, but includes extra metadata like time stamp, link to other related bwav files (typical upon non linear editing).

NorPix is a leading developer of digital video recording software for acquiring live video directly to hard disk or RAM. User applications of NorPix products include motion analysis, image archiving, flow analysis, medical imaging and web inspection.
